Logan Salyer
and Clarinda Godsey

Logan Henry Neal Salyer b 31 May 1835 Nickelsville, Scott Co VA d 3 May 1916 Whitesburg, Letcher Co KY; s/o Samuel Salyer and Lydia Culbertson. Logan Henry Neal Salyer m. 10 Aug 1854 to Clerinda J Godsey b 1829 Scott Co VA d 1881. Children of Logan Henry Neal Salyer and Clerinda Godsey;

1. Dicy E Salyer b 1851

2. Helen C Salyer b 15 Jul 1855 Scott Co VA d Jun 1918; m. (1) Judge S E Baker. Helen C Salyer m. 7 Oct 1875 Scott Co VA to Enos Hilton b ? d 1891 Norton VA; Enos was shot to death in the fall of 1891 in Norton, Wise County, Virginia, by Talt Hall, while serving a warrant on Hall's cousin, Miles Bates.

3. Drury Wallace Salyer b 31 Mar 1857 Scott Co VA d 8 Mar 1932 Whitesburg, Letcher Co KY; m. 20 Mar 1879 Wise Co VA to Hester Ann Bruce b 28 Dec 1861 d 26 Nov 1944.

4. Lydia A Salyer b 15 Dec 1858 Scott Co VA d 3 Feb 1862

5. Harriet M Hattie Salyer b 1 Feb 1862 Scott Co VA d 1936 Norton, Wise Co VA; m. 23 Dec 1886 Wise Co VA to Sylvan M Taylor

Colonel Logan Salyer
In The Civil War

Note: Colonel Salyer had charge of the unit of Wise County in the Civil War. He fought in the battles of Fort Donaldson, Seven Pines, Fredricksburg, Gettysburg, Chancellorsville and Antietam. He stated that 101 men enlisted at the time he did and only two of them came out untouched by shot, shell or saber. In one battle he had sixteen holes shot through his clothes. He said "At Fort Donaldson, I was shot through the body while leading my men in the fight, and was sent away by steamboat crowded with the wounded to Nashville, Davidson County, Tennessee. A soldier in the struggle of death fell across my body and died there. He lay on me a long time for there was no one to remove him and I was too weak from loss of blood to do it. I finally recovered sufficiently to rejoin my regiment." "At Chancellorsville, I received a wound across my head by a sword in a bayonet charge. I fell unconscious. The Federals threw me in a ditch face down for dead. The sisters of charity who were picking up the wounded noticed I was a Confederate Officer and turned me over and found I was still breathing."
